News Shooter (Thursday, 4 May, 2023) - ARRI has announced a new Capture Drive XR 1024 GB, which is available as a limited edition for legacy ALEXA XT and XR cameras. The Capture Drive XR is built utilizing the latest solid-state drive technology, and it offers 960 GB of usable capacity and supports the same high-speed ARRIRAW... - Nikon Z8 vs. Sony a7RV vs. Canon EOS R5 specifications comparison

News Shooter (Wednesday, 3 May, 2023) - The new Sabrent Rocket CFX Type B (CF-XXIT) memory cards come in 512GB, 1TB & 2TB of capacity with claimed read/write speeds of up to 1,800/1,700 MB/s and sustained writes of up to 1,300 MB/s. Sabrent states the memory cards contain SSD-quality hardware with a powerful controller and fast flash memory with... - How Adobe Creative Cloud Helped Capture the Ten-year Anniversary of the Red Bull Stratos Space Jump
